We photograph every item. spine creasing, edge wear; New Canadian Library N 98; Both a historic romance and a literary novel - full of action; a Negro uprising, the search for missing treasure on the Spanish Main, hotly contested sea-fights, sword-play, and suspense, portrayed with the deeper tensions of man's struggle for integrity, vision, and mastery of his own fate.
